A swim coach has at most $800 to buy equipment for the swim team. Each pull buoys costs $5.50 and each kickboard costs $10. Let
olga2289 [7]

Answer:

  A)  5.50x + 10y ≤ 800

  B)  yes

  C)  no

  D)  80 pull buoys and 35 kick boards

Step-by-step explanation:

A) The sum of costs must not exceed the budget:

  5.50x +10.00y ≤ 800

__

B) 5.50(0) +10.00(50) = 500 ≤ 800 . . . . . yes, the coach could buy these

__

C) 5.50(125) +10.00(25) = 937.50 > 800 . . . no, they cost too much

__

D) The point (80, 35) is in the solution space. The coach could buy 80 pull buoys and 35 kick boards.
